Materials and Finishes That Stand Up to Real-World Use
Longevity depends on the right alloy and the correct surface system for the environment. You choose materials based on load, exposure, and maintenance requirements. For coastal or deicing-salt conditions, specify 316 for outstanding Stainless corrosion resistance; for interiors or mild exposure, 304 performs effectively. When weight matters, select 6061-T6 aluminum and hardcoat anodize to improve wear resistance. For carbon steel structures, prioritize galvanizing for sacrificial protection, then apply a high-build topcoat.
You control coating longevity by pairing coating chemistry to service class. Powder coat performance relies on substrate prep: SSPC-SP 10 near-white blast, a zinc-rich primer, and a TGIC-polyester topcoat cured to spec. Verify with DFT readings, crosshatch adhesion, and salt-spray testing. Record callouts on drawings to ensure repeatable performance.

What CAD File Formats Are Accepted for Designs?
You're able to submit STEP and IGES, SolidWorks Parasolid (x_t/x_b), native SLDPRT/SLDASM, DXF for 2D profiles, and STL formats for meshes. We also accept DWG, PDF with dimensions, and DXF STEP hybrids as needed. For production purposes, give preference to STEP for solids and DXF for flat patterns; use STL only for reference or additive. Make sure to include units, material, tolerances, and revision. Our team will validate geometry, correct import issues, and confirm critical features.
